Bean Tostada

The BEST bean tostada recipe! This easy bean tostada recipe is baked (not fried) and made with black beans, salsa, and choice of toppings.

Ingredients

For the Tostadas:
  • 4 corn tortillas (6-inch)
  • 1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
  • ½ small red onion
  • ¼ te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1 can reduced-sodium black beans (15 ounces) rinsed and drained
  • ⅓ cup prepared salsa plus additional for serving
Optional Toppings:
  • Diced avocado
  • diced red onion
  • sliced cabbage
  • shredded cheese (I used queso fresco)
  • sour cream or plain Greek yogurt
  • salsa
  • diced tomatoes
  • jalapeño slices
  • fresh cilantro
  • freshly squeezed lime juice

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. In a medium saucepan, heat 1 tablespoon olive oil over medium-high. Dice the onion, then add it and the salt and cook 2 minutes, until just beginning to soften.
  2. Add the black beans and 1/4 cup salsa and stir to coat with the oil and onions. Cook, stirring periodically, until heated through, about 4 minutes. Mash and set aside.
  3. Meanwhile, spread the tortillas in a single layer on a baking sheet, then place in the oven until crisp, about 6 minutes, flipping the tortillas once halfway through. Prepare any desired toppings.
  4. To serve, spoon the black beans over the crisp tortillas, then pile on the toppings. Enjoy immediately.

Notes

  • TO STORE: Bean tostadas are best enjoyed right after serving. However, leftover bean mixture may be stored in the refrigerator for up to 4 days in a covered container.
  • TO REHEAT: Warm the bean mixture in a skillet over medium heat until heated through. Then spread over freshly baked tortillas and top as desired. Alternatively, you may also microwave the beans, in a microwave-safe container, until steaming.
  • TO FREEZE: The bean mixture may be stored in the freezer, in an airtight container, for up to 3 months. Defrost overnight in the refrigerator before warming.
  • NOTE: Depending upon how quickly your oven preheats and how many garnishes are selected, you may need more than 10 minutes to fully prepare this recipe. That said, it is still a quick, healthy, and delicious meal!
